Why I Pay More for Epilog: The Cost of Certainty When Every Hour Counts

I coordinate equipment procurement for a contract manufacturing shop that regularly takes on rush orders. In this role, I've learned a hard truth: when the deadline is 48 hours away and a client's entire event depends on your delivery, the cheapest option isn't just risky – it's expensive.

Here's my take: if you're in a situation where time is money (and let's be honest, when isn't it?), paying the Epilog laser fusion price – which often sits 20-40% above entry-level competitors – isn't a luxury. It's insurance. And in my experience, the premium for certainty almost always pays for itself.

How I Learned This the Hard Way

In March 2024, a client called at 9:00 AM needing 200 custom laser-engraved tumblers for a product launch the following day. Normal turnaround for that volume is 3-4 days. They had already ordered a laser machine for tumblers from a discount brand, but the machine arrived damaged and couldn't hold alignment. We had to scramble.

We found a local shop with an Epilog Fusion Pro that could handle the job – but their rush fee was $400 on top of the $1,200 base cost. Altogether $1,600 for something we could have done in-house for $300 in materials.

I still kick myself for not buying an Epilog in the first place. If we'd had one, we'd have cut that $1,600 to zero and saved the client's trust. (Thankfully, the launch went fine – but we lost that client's next order because they remembered our 'last-minute' panic.)

The moral: The $400 rush fee was a bargain compared to missing a $15,000 event. And the difference between a $10,000 Epilog and a $6,000 budget laser? That $4,000 is the cost of knowing your machine will work when you need it most.

Why Epilog Delivers Certainty (and Budget Lasers Don't)

I've evaluated a lot of laser systems over the years – CO₂, fiber, UV. Here are three reasons I keep coming back to Epilog for time-critical work:

1. Delivery & Deployment Are Predictable

When I search for epilog laser for sale, I know the lead time is typically 5-10 business days. Many budget brands quote 7 days but actually ship in 3-4 weeks – and sometimes arrive with missing parts or calibration issues. In a rush, that uncertainty is poison.

“In 2023, we ordered a 'ship in 48 hours' budget laser. It took 11 days. We paid $850 in expedited freight (which the vendor refused to refund), and the gantry was misaligned. We burned 3 more days fixing it. Total hidden cost: $1,300 and a lost contract.”

Epilog's authorized dealers keep stock. I can call, confirm inventory, and have a machine on a truck within 24 hours if needed. That kind of certainty is worth a lot when you're facing a penalty clause.

2. Speed to First Job – Laser vs. CNC Router

When a client asks, “laser cutter vs cnc router which is faster for rush orders?”, my answer is always laser – if it's a reliable laser. A cheap laser might need 2-3 hours of setup, alignment, and test cuts. A well-maintained Epilog is ready to run in 20 minutes.

For the tumbler job I mentioned, the CNC router would have taken 5 hours just to fixture the curved surfaces. The Epilog did the same work in 1.5 hours, including layout. That saved 3.5 hours – enough to meet the deadline comfortably.

3. Aluminum Laser Welding? Not for Hobby Machines

Some clients ask about aluminum laser welding attachments for their laser engravers. While it's possible with high-power pulsed fiber lasers (Epilog's Fiber series handles it), cheap units can't deliver the spot stability needed for consistent welds. The result: discoloration, weak joints, and scrap parts.

I've seen a shop lose an entire $8,000 batch of aluminum components because their budget laser's pulse control drifted mid-run. They had to redo everything overnight with a rented Epilog fiber – at $2,000 rental cost plus $700 in wasted material. The 'savings' from buying cheap evaporated.

Defending the Premium – What Critics Say

I know the counterarguments: “You're just pushing an expensive brand” or “I can get 90% of the results for half the price.”

Look – I'm not saying Epilog is right for every situation. If you're making signs for your own garage and have no deadlines, a $4,000 machine is fine. But in B2B, 90% of the results can be 100% of a problem when that missing 10% is reliability.

Here's the thing: budget lasers can work. I've seen it. But they work with higher variance. When you're juggling multiple rush orders, variance is your enemy. One bad board, one failed tube, one week of downtime – and your reputation takes a hit that lasts years.

Paying more for Epilog isn't about bragging rights. It's about buying a known quantity. You know the support network, you know the parts availability, you know the performance envelope. In emergency situations, that knowledge is gold.

Final Word: The Math of Certainty

Let me give you a simple framework I use. If the probability of a critical failure in a budget laser during a rush order is, say, 15% – and that failure would cost you $5,000 in lost revenue and penalty fees – the expected loss is $750. The premium to upgrade to an Epilog might be $3,000. That math only works if you get many rush orders over the machine's life.

But the numbers don't capture the sleepless nights, the client anger, or the “why didn't we go with the proven brand?” regret. For me, after 200+ rush orders in 6 years, the certainty is worth the premium.

Don't hold me to this exact pricing – this was accurate as of early 2025. Markets change. But the principle doesn't: when time is tight, the cheapest option is rarely the cheapest in the end.
